What is the value of x in the equation 1.5(x + 4) – 3 = 4.5(x - 2)? O 3 O 4 O 5 09

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

1.5x + 6 - 3 = 4.5x - 9

1.5x + 3 = 4.5x - 9

Bringing like terms on one side

3 + 9 = 4.5x - 1. 5x

12 = 3x

12/3 = x

4 = x
